Output 4257907217279c6e3790ef8f50af4b918cc63c70a9faa1b50b2417ceda4e07e1:1

value
908911935
script pubkey
OP_0 OP_PUSHBYTES_20 cf51573635dab2671775617aed3ffc633ee70299
address
bc1qeag4wd34m2exw9m4v9aw60luvvlwwq5en90mhf
transaction
4257907217279c6e3790ef8f50af4b918cc63c70a9faa1b50b2417ceda4e07e1
confirmations
364966
spent
true